Mumbai, December 30: After passing comment on Mumbai and comparing it with Pakistan Occupied Kashmir, Bollywood actress Kangana Ranaut returned to Mumbai on Monday and visited Shri Siddhivinayak temple.
The actress posted pictures of herself in Mumbai and said she recalled the "hostility" that she faced for standing up for "beloved city". Ironically, she is the same Kangana who earlier had spoken utter nonsense about Mumbai.
Furthermore, in the caption, she added that she feels protected and safe in Mumbai. It should be noted that she earlier had said that she didn't feel safe in the city. Apart from Siddhivinayak temple she also visited Mumba Devi temple with her sister and took the blessing for the upcoming project.
Kangana tweeted, "The amount of hostility I faced for standing up for my beloved city Mumbai baffled me, today I went to Mumba Devi and Shri Siddhivinayak Ji and got their blessings, I feel protected, loved and welcomed. Jai Hind Jai Maharashtra.”
